Course abstract

In the course exploitation conditions of structures and necessity of renovation is analysed. Renovation exercises of building renovation are discussed taking into account foundation deformations, processes in base and changes of base properties. Renovation methods and calculations are discussed together with renovation technology.

Learning outcomes and their assessment

Knowledge about reliability estimation of structures and foundations and renovation methods; skills to estimate technical situation of structures and base and perform design of renovation; competence to define foundation renovation problem, choose calculation method and evaluate the acquired results.
